Author Topic: Indicator Inserts for JayEl and Aerospace Optics indicators  (Read 6983 times)

After trying several materials I settled on a 2 part lens, surface lens with legends and rear acrylic clear spacer. The legend face has a stipple finish as similar to the original ones. 14.87mm square as the originals. These will fit both JayEl and AO indicators. I included the ECM indicators in the set at the same size for those doing those themselves. Also the Marker Beacon ,ENBL and Run indicators. Included in the pics below are 2 original legends,(for reference) one from a JayEl and one from an AO indicator. These are reverse engraved, as you can see, all that's needed to make the center legends white on the TWP, TWA and ECM legends is to backfill white on the center engraved letters. Excess does not need to be removed, just be careful not to bleed over into the outer letters. Also, all legends are clear and require a colored bulb or filter. Included are the legends pictured in the fist picture below and 32 square clear spacers and 3 round spacers. Spacer were not made for the ECM legends as they do not use JayEL type switches.
